In this emotionally provocative rock opera, composer-writer-performer Imani Uzuri explores the journey from isolation into meditative stillness that leads to the exuberant triumph of self-expression. Backed by a full ambient band with strings, Her Holy Water: A Black Girl's Rock Opera is a lyrical, often humorous unique-concert-experience. Told through drum and bass arias, transformational ballads, and soulful rock, the performance also incorporates coming-of-age memories from Uzuri's youth in rural North Carolina and anectdotes from her nomadic travels around the world. Her Holy Water is a celebration confirming that even the minutiae of a Black Girl's life is epic and universal. "Uzuri never fails to mesmerize audiences," says Time Out New York.
